What is a Safety Data Sheet (SDS)? 

According to OSHA (Occupational Safety and Health Administration), every Safety Data Sheet (SDS) must include key information about the chemical—such as its properties, associated physical and health hazards, environmental risks, protective measures, and safety guidelines. This helps ensure that anyone handling the chemical is fully aware of the dangers and the steps needed to stay safe. 

SDSs are especially important in workplaces where chemicals are commonly used, such as factories, hospitals, cleaning services, and laboratories. They serve as a critical safety resource, guiding employees on what to do in case of accidental spills, exposure, or other emergencies. 

In the U.S., OSHA requires that each hazardous chemical must have its own SDS, and it must be made available to all employees. To make the information easy to use, each SDS follows a standardized 16-section format, allowing users to quickly find the safety details they need in any situation. 

 

The 16 Sections of an SDS Explained Simply 

 

1.Identification

This section gives the name of the chemical, its use, and the contact details of the supplier or manufacturer. 

 

2.Hazard(s) Identification

Informs what dangers the chemical has—like if it’s flammable, toxic, or causes skin irritation. 

3.Composition/Information on Ingredients

The third section lists what’s inside the product, including any harmful ingredients. 

 

4.First-Aid Measures

The fourth section explains what to do if someone is exposed to the chemical (like inhaling it, touching it, or getting it in their eyes). 

 

5.Fire-Fighting Measures

Shares information on how to put out a fire caused by the chemical, including what type of extinguisher to use. 

 

6.Accidental Release Measures

Tells you how to safely clean up a spill or leak of the chemical. 

 

7.Handling and Storage

Explains how to use the chemical safely and where/how to store it to avoid accidents. 

 

8.Exposure Controls/Personal Protection

Lists safety equipment you should use (like gloves or masks) and limits for safe exposure. 

 

9.Physical and Chemical Properties

The ninth section describes what the chemical looks like, smells like, and how it behaves (like boiling point, color, etc.). 

 

10.Stability and Reactivity

This section explains how stable the chemical is under normal conditions.  

 

11.Toxicological Information

Explains how the chemical might affect your health if you’re exposed to it—like causing dizziness or long-term effects. 

 

12.Ecological Information

Gives details on how the chemical might harm the environment (like rivers, soil, or wildlife). 

 

13.Disposal Considerations

Provides guidance on how to safely dispose of the chemical and its containers.  

 

14.Transport Information

Section 14 explains how the chemical should be packed and labeled when being shipped. 

 

15.Regulatory Information

Lists the safety laws and rules that apply to chemicals. 

 

16.Other Information

Includes the date the SDS was created or updated, and sometimes additional notes from the manufacturer. 

 

Importance Of Safety Data Sheets:

 

SDSs serve as a foundation for chemical safety. Here’s why they matter: 

  1. To Improve Workplace Safety

SDSs help employees understand how to handle harmful chemicals safely. It explains what personal protective equipment (PPE) to use, how to store the substances properly, and what steps to take if there’s accidental exposure.  

 

  1. Regulatory Compliance

Organizations like OSHA (Occupational Safety and Health Administration) require employers to maintain and provide access to SDSs for all hazardous materials on-site. Clearly, non-compliance can lead to heavy penalties. 

 

  1. Emergency Response

In case of a chemical spill or exposure, SDSs offer essential first-aid steps and clean-up instructions. Having quick access to this information can help prevent serious injuries and even save lives. 

 

  1. Training and Awareness

SDSs are used in employee training programs. These documents help build awareness around chemical hazards, proper usage, and response actions. 

 

Who Needs Access to SDSs? 

Safety Data Sheets (SDSs) are not just for safety officers or managers—they’re for everyone who works with or around hazardous chemicals. 

Here’s a simple breakdown of who needs access: 

 

i) Employees Handling Chemicals:  

Anyone who uses, mixes, or comes into contact with chemicals needs to know the risks involved and how to protect themselves. 

 

ii) Supervisors and Safety Personnel:  

They need SDSs to train employees, manage chemical safety, and respond to emergencies. 

 

iii) Emergency Responders:  

Firefighters, medical teams, or hazmat crews require SDSs to understand what they’re dealing with during a chemical-related incident. 

 

iv) Cleaning and Maintenance Staff:  

Even basic cleaning supplies can be hazardous. That’s why maintenance staff must have access to SDSs. 

 

v) Health and Safety Auditors:  

Inspectors or internal teams require access to SDS databases to ensure the workplace is complying with safety laws and regulations. 

 

How to Ensure SDSs and Their Information Are Always Accessible? 

 Here’s how your organization can make sure everyone can find the information they need, when they need it: 

 

1.Centralized Digital Storage

Store SDSs in a centralized digital system or software that can be accessed by all employees from any device. This is the easiest way to ensure that up-to-date information is always just a few clicks away. 

 

2.Physical Copies in Key Locations 

Keep printed SDSs in binders at locations that are easy to reach. Place them in break rooms, maintenance areas, and storage facilities—especially near places where chemicals are used.

 

3.Clear Labeling and Organization 

 Organize SDSs by product name or category and label them clearly. This helps employees quickly find the right sheet in an emergency. 

 

4.Regular Reviews and Updates  

Ensure SDSs are regularly reviewed and updated. Outdated information can be dangerous and lead to compliance issues. 

 

5.Use SDS Management Software 

Use SDS management tools that send alerts when a new SDS is added. These tools also notify users when an existing SDS is updated, keeping everyone informed in real-time.
